Best Pet Shop Close to Me Petofy happens to be the best pet organization suppliers in India. We know the way tough it definitely is for pet dad and Mother to uncover all the best pet corporations in a single spot. Petofy gives you the top thorough pet shops in https://royalcaninpetnutrition86419.wikipublicity.com/7333107/everything_about_dubai_pet_food